New Poll Shows Partisan Differences on Views About Higher Education

Inside Higher Education reports that a new poll from the Pew Research Center shows partisan differences in people's views about whether higher education is having a positive impact on the United States, with 67% of Democrats saying yes and just 33% of Republicans saying yes. From Inside Higher Education: "Rather than a temporary blip, the Pew findings suggest a continuing challenge for college leaders hoping to maintain or repair a bipartisan consensus in support of postsecondary education."
